A slideshow presented to UTU members attending the union’s conductor certification workshop at the Portland, Ore., regional meeting is now available on the UTU website.
The slideshow can be downloaded as a PowerPoint presentation by clicking here or in PDF format here.
The FRA’s final rule on conductor certification follows many of the provisions of locomotive engineer certification, with a number of improvements the UTU was able to obtain.
